The Album Show presents ‘The West Coast 70’s”

2pm Saturday 11th October 2025

 

 Presented by the Pearl Beach Progress Association &

The Pearl Beach Arboretum 

Tickets on sale, ‘Early Bird’ discount!


The Pearl Beach Arboretum is the host venue for this show consisting of a 6 piece show band of experienced and accomplished musicians/singers, playing a set list of bonafide hits from one of the most significant periods in the development of contemporary pop music, the ‘California’ scene from the 70’s. This period was the perfect melting pot of rock and roll, pop and country music at a time that showed the emergence of the singer-songwriter.

 

Showcasing the biggest hits of The Eagles, James Taylor, Fleetwood Mac, Linda Ronstadt, The Doobie Brothers and many many more, this two hour plus show, featuring a whole band of vocalists (including Sophie Jones and Michael Carpenter) and first rate musicians, the show will take you on a journey where you’ll see how interwoven the paths of these artists were, and hear a timeless catalogue of material.

 

The band features proven singers and multi-instrumentalists, who exist in a time capsule that makes them perfectly suited to this period of music!

 

The Pearl Beach Progress Association and the Pearl Beach Arboretum are not-for-profit community-based organisations which rely on revenue from events and activities to manage environmental projects and local facilities.

Don’t miss out on this unique musical opportunity, to have some fun, and dance along to iconic music we all know and love. Patrons are encouraged to bring a chair, picnic and rug. There will be ample parking available near the Tennis Courts, access via Tourmaline Road.
